Located in the district of Ginnheim, this 330-metre / 1,083-foot high communications tower has graced the city's skyline since 1978, when its construction was completed by the German post office . The locals refer to it as 'asparagus tower' on account of it size and shape. However, in reality, its 3,000 tons of steel and 20,000 square metres of concrete bear only a passing resemblance to the vegetable.

If you buy at auction, you won’t be able to inspect the inside of the house beforehand. People in financial difficulty — so severe that they are losing their homes — probably didn’t make repairs or even keep up with routine maintenance. Water damage, plumbing problems, HVAC issues and even cracks in the foundation can cost thousands of dollars to fix. Most first-time buyers want a house they don’t have to work on.

Norges Bank said inflation — which reached 6.5% in November — has “risen rapidly” and “is markedly above target.” The hike, which brought its key policy rate to 2.75%, was a slower pace than the U.S. Federal Reserve took Wednesday and Swiss National bank took a day later.
